What is the rent comparison between Brussels and Vienna?

In Brussels, a 1-bedroom apartment in the city center costs approximately $1,200/month. In Vienna, the equivalent is around $1,150/month.

What is the average income in Brussels vs Vienna?

The median net monthly salary in Brussels is approximately $3,030 USD, compared to $2,600 USD in Vienna.
